Roachtest overview

Roachtest is a test framework for integration testing of CockroachDB.

In a nutshell, it consists of:

  • a test suite in the crdb repo (pkg/cmd/roachtest/tests)

  • a framework that invokes roachprod under the hood

  • (roachprod is our general-purpose manual testing framework for cockroachdb deployment.)

The roachtest framework is documented as markdown files inside the repo:

